Jeremiah 14:5
Even the doe in the field deserts her newborn fawn because there is no grass.
BSB
Parallel translations (2) ▾
ASV
Yea, the hind also in the field calveth, and forsaketh her young, because there is no grass.
KJV
Yea, the hind also calved in the field, and forsook it, because there was no grass.
